‘Deep Down’ the Spankers Know Assemblywoman Lieber’s Bill is Right On

Dear Editor,

Assemblywoman Sally Lieber should not be discouraged by all the snide reactions, snickering and cheap shots her spanking ban proposal has provoked. Such noise is an inevitable part of the process that accompanies every true reform. She should be proud and confident. She knows she’s on the right track. And deep down, the spankers know it, too.

We all remember the grumbling and threats of rebellion when safe, law-abiding drivers were ordered to buckle up, and when honest, tax-paying homeowners were informed that they could no longer burn their own leaves in their own backyards. Good laws pave the way for good behaviors, and in the end we have to admit, sometimes government gets things right.

Thoughtful, informed people know there is no practical, ethical or moral justification for discriminating against children by denying them equal protection under the law. Husbands and wives can’t settle their differences anymore by hitting each other, employers can’t hit employees, prison guards can’t hit convicts. There is only one hitable class left. But not for long, thanks to people like Ms. Lieber.

Jordan Riak, Alamo

Why Was Former Tow Operator Allowed to File Such ‘Frivolous’ Lawsuits?

Dear Editor,

Why has former tow truck company operator Paul Greer been allowed to file such frivolous cases? This man just goes after those who do not have any knowledge of their rights, or that they have options. My co-worker was also falsely accused of owing towing charges for a towed car that no longer was in her possession.

She did defend herself, but after MANY HOURS OF HAVING to research and track down paperwork she should not have had to do. When she called to drop off the proof of release of liability, his office gave her the wrong office address. They were located in an unmarked obscure location. It was only them that he stopped harassing her and threatening to garnish her wages. Why has he not been charged with harassment and wrongful suits in the courts?

And why would he change not just his name, first and last, but his entire family including his children? Unscrupulous morals perhaps?

Mary Haro, Hollister
